Defining Reliability in the Context of Servers Reliability in server technology refers to the ability of the server to operate continuously without failure, ensuring services and applications are always available to users. It encompasses various aspects, including hardware integrity, software stability, security measures, and the support infrastructure. For businesses, a reliable server means minimized downtime, enhanced security, and sustained productivity.
Hardware Quality and Performance The foundation of a best dedicated server lies in its hardware. High-quality components from reputable manufacturers are less likely to fail and can significantly enhance overall server performance. Brands like Dell, HP, and IBM are known for their robust server hardware, designed to handle heavy loads and operate under extensive operational demands. Furthermore, hardware reliability ensures better server uptime, a crucial element for business-critical operations.
Data Center Infrastructure A dedicated server's reliability is also dependent on the infrastructure of the data center where it is housed. Essential features include:
- Redundancy systems: These are crucial for power supply, cooling, and data storage, ensuring the server remains operational even if one component fails.
- Geographical location: Data centers located in areas with minimal exposure to natural disasters contribute to greater server reliability.
Network Connectivity and Bandwidth Server reliability is significantly affected by its network environment. Adequate bandwidth and robust connectivity ensure that data flows smoothly and access is uninterrupted. Features like multiple network interfaces and failover strategies are vital, as they help maintain connectivity even during an outage.
Security Features Security is a critical component of server reliability. Dedicated servers equipped with the latest security protocols fend off attacks more effectively, preserving data integrity and availability. Regular updates, patch management, and advanced security measures like firewalls and intrusion detection systems are essential to safeguard servers against emerging threats.
Technical Support and Service Level Agreements (SLAs) Technical support plays a vital role in maintaining server reliability. A responsive and knowledgeable support team can quickly resolve issues that might otherwise lead to prolonged downtime. Moreover, robust SLAs commit the service provider to maintain high uptime percentages and quick recovery times, thus ensuring reliability.
Scalability and Flexibility Reliable servers must be scalable and flexible to respond to business growth or changing needs. This ability to scale up resources without significant downtime is a hallmark of a reliable server setup. It allows businesses to expand their operations seamlessly and ensures that the server environment remains robust and responsive.
